Victorville (CA) – It seems like Caltech’s ALICE bot has a liking for human-driven chase cars at the DARPA Urban Challenge qualifications. During one qualification run, the robotic minivan repeatedly went out of its assigned lane and veered towards the chase cars. One of the human drivers even screeched his tires to get out of the way.
Video of Caltech's "scary" Course A run Caltech was eliminated from the Urban Challenge qualifications yesterday.
